The term "superregenerative" primarily refers to a specific technology used in radio communications and signal processing. It describes a type of receiver that enhances weak signals by repeatedly amplifying them, thus making them clearer and easier to interpret. This technology is particularly significant in the development of low-power devices that require sensitivity in detecting signals at minimal energy costs.

At its core, superregenerative technology leverages the process of regenerative amplification. The fundamental technique involves the use of a device that periodically dumps energy into an oscillating circuit. This process causes the circuit to momentarily enter a state of oscillation, boosting the weak incoming signals. Here are the key principles:
